Depositing into an online broker from Kiribati usually means using international payment rails. Both AvaTrade and Moneta Markets accept Bank Transfer, Skrill, and Neteller. Bank transfers are slow because they go through correspondents in Australia or the US; you might lose 1-2% in intermediation fees. Skrill and Neteller are faster and can be funded from a Visa/MasterCard or another e-wallet. Moneta Markets also accepts USDT TRC20, which is a major advantage for a Pacific trader who already uses crypto wallets with low fees; it settles in minutes. AvaTrade does not support direct USDT deposits, so if you plan to pay in stablecoins, Moneta Markets is the practical option. We recommend that Kiribati traders avoid credit-card deposits because many local cards are not set up for FX transactions. Start with a small deposit via Skrill or Neteller to verify the broker's process, then move to larger amounts.

Retail traders in Kiribati who hold positions overnight need to know how swap charges apply. AvaTrade and Moneta Markets both offer Islamic, swap-free accounts for Muslim clients. Both brokers will process your request after you confirm your religious status. On these accounts, no overnight interest is charged, but there may be increased spreads or a service fee. Given the small Muslim population in Kiribati, local banks rarely offer Sharia-compliant trading; therefore, brokers are the main option. Always confirm that the broker's swap-free policy still applies to the specific instruments you plan to trade, such as gold and USD pairs.

Final Verdict - Kiribati 2026

AvaTrade wins overall

For most Kiribati retail traders, AvaTrade is the clear winner in this matchup. Its stronger regulation, stable platforms, commission-free pricing, and excellent support make it a safer foundation for building trading capital in USD. Moneta Markets is not a bad broker; it offers a competitive ECN product and a USDT TRC20 deposit route, which AvaTrade lacks. But in a market like Kiribati where there is no direct protection from the local financial regulator, the trust factor and operational history of AvaTrade matter more than a slightly lower spread. Ultimately, your decision should depend on your typical trading style, your payment choice, and how much you value local deposit flexibility. If you use Skrill, Neteller, or a standard bank transfer, AvaTrade is the better choice. If you want to deposit via Tether reliably and you trade high volume, Moneta Markets deserves a second look.
